
Daozang (Taoist Canon)
The Daozang, or Taoist Canon, is an extensive collection of sacred texts that form the core literature of Taoism. Compiled over centuries, it encompasses scriptures, philosophical writings, rituals, and practices aimed at understanding and harmonizing with the Dao, the fundamental principle of the universe. The canon serves as a spiritual and doctrinal guide, reflecting Taoist beliefs about nature, morality, and immortality. Its comprehensive nature offers insight into Taoist religion, philosophy, and ways of living in harmony with the natural world.
